WebThere is just one federal holiday in October: Columbus Day. Columbus Day is on the second Monday of October which falls between October 8th and October 14th. This holiday honors Christopher Columbus. WebDuring the holiday season, children may begin exhibiting behaviors that indicate stress: Tears for a minor reason or for no reason at all. Nervous behaviors – nail biting and hair twirling. Physical complaints – headaches and stomach aches. Regression to younger behaviors – bedwetting, temper tantrums.
